    Repairing a damaged piston

    Composite doors are durable and a great investment for any home, however they're not impervious to damage or faults. They may be warped or swell in the frame and can be difficult to lock and close. There is a quick fix that will save you time and money.

    The locking mechanism sticking is the most frequent problem. When dust, dirt and debris accumulate inside the internal mechanisms of a door cylinder sticky locks can develop. This can make it difficult to turn the lock or insert it, and even cause an unusable key. This issue is easily fixed by using a silicone-based grease.

    Start by loosening slightly the screws that secure the strike plate. Then, you can move it either vertically or horizontally to align it with the latch. After you've done that then tighten the screws. This will ensure that your piston is properly engaged and will stop the door from sliding or warping in the future.

    If you're still experiencing issues, it might be a good idea to consult an expert. A uPVC expert can help you identify the problem and provide a solution. If the problem is with the multipoint locking system it could be necessary to replace the entire mechanism. In this scenario it is recommended to hire locksmiths who are familiar with these kinds of doors and mechanisms. They can assist you to find the issue and fix it as quickly as they can. They can also guide you on the most secure security options for your door. It's important that you choose high-security locks that are Kite Marked and certified to BS3621. They are more resistant to forced entry attempts and are covered under your insurance policy. This makes them a good choice for your new composite doors. For added security, it is recommended to install an Yale alarm installed on your property. Many insurance companies require this extra security feature as part of the policy.

    Repairing a damaged hinge

    A faulty hinge on a composite door can be a major issue and could compromise your home security. It is usually not a problem that is difficult to fix. You just need to be careful when doing the repair and use the right tools. It is recommended to contact an expert locksmith if you aren't sure what to do. This will prevent you from invalidating your home insurance policy and causing the issue to get worse.

    One of the most common issues with black composite door scratch repair doors is that they become sticky. This is due to dust or debris building up within the lock's internal mechanism. This can be fixed by spraying the lock with liquid lubricant. It is recommended to use a lubricant that is specifically designed for locks and doors. Other alternatives like WD-40 could damage the lock and shouldn't be used.

    Warping is another issue that can be found in composite doors. This is usually caused by extreme weather conditions, and can affect both the frame and door. This can cause gaps around the edges of the door, which allow rainwater and drafts to enter your home. This could also affect locking mechanisms and make it difficult for you to close the door.

    It is best to keep the door closed as much as you can, and then lift the handle upwards when closing it. This will help to take pressure off the middle lock and prevent warping.

    Not least, you must ensure whether the hinges have been tightened. If you notice that the screws are loose then you can tighten them by unscrewing the hinges and screwing them back in. You should also consider replacing the screws with a bit longer length. This will save you time and money, and will ensure that the hinges are secured.

    These steps are simple enough to fix a broken hinge quickly and easily. Additionally, it's recommended to oil the hinges regularly to avoid any problems with them. This is especially true if your door is frequently used.

    Repairing a damaged Lock

    A damaged lock could affect the security of your home. That's why it's important to look out for signs that your door's cylinder hinges, or key mechanism aren't working in the way they should.

    This guide will teach you how to fix some of the most common problems that come with composite doors. By following these tips you'll be able have peace of mind and make sure that your home is secure and secure.

    One of the most frequently encountered problems with composite doors is that they could expand, warp or bow. This is due to fluctuations in humidity and temperature. This can be solved by following a few simple guidelines. It is best to first get into the habit of throwing the handle upwards each time you shut your composite door (also known as throwing the replacement lock for composite door). This will ensure that all locking points are engaged, and will prevent any future swells, bowing or warping.

    Another problem with composite doors is that they can be difficult to close and lock. This can be due to a range of reasons, such as poor quality or a lack in maintenance. If your composite door hasn't been properly lubricated it may be stuck or not latch correctly. This could be a problem for your home's energy efficiency and can also compromise the security of your home.

    If you notice that your composite door is squeezing, it's a good idea to use silicone lubricant on the inside of the lock. This will smooth out the mechanism and prevent any issues with your lock's cylinder, key or hinges. This should be performed at least once a week to ensure that your composite doors are in good condition.

    If you're having trouble turning the key in your composite door, it's likely that you have a faulty euro cylinder or mechanism. A locksmith will be able to fix this for you and supply you with new keys. In extreme circumstances the replacement lock for composite door of the entire mechanism might be necessary.

    Replacing a damaged lock

    Composite doors are built to last, but they require regular maintenance to stay in top condition. This includes lubricating the hinges as well as removing any dents to allow you to close and lock your door. It is also essential to look out for the signs of deterioration of your weather seals as they could allow drafts and rainwater enter your home. If your door is leaking or has deteriorated you must consult a professional for help to fix the issue.

    A defective locking system could be one of composite doors' most annoying and frustrating issues. It can make it difficult to open or close your door, which could be a serious safety issue for you and your family. The good part is that you can fix most of these issues easily. Whether your problem is with the cylinder or the internal locking mechanism the following steps will help you get your door back up and running in no time.

    A issue with your door lock is usually caused by the internal mechanism becoming stuck. This could be due to dust, dirt, or debris build-up inside the locking cylinder or hinges. You can bring back the functionality of your composite doors using a graphite or silicone oil. It's best to do this every six months or so to avoid any future issues with your composite door.

    A malfunctioning locking mechanism is a common problem. If one of the parts of the multipoint locking system fails, you may have difficulty unlocking or closing the door. A professional locksmith can resolve this issue by replacing the malfunctioning component and then providing new keys.

    If your composite door is bent, or the hinges rust and become difficult to open and close the door. This could lead to an increase in safety and increase the risk of water leaks. The simplest solution to this issue is to simply change the hinges that can be done quickly using a few tools.
